§ 2.178.020. Purposes and mission.  


Latest version.
  • A.

    The metropolitan council hereby finds and declares that the establishment of a SONA CBID will promote the successful revitalization and modernization of the business district within South Nashville, thereby furthering the health, safety, and general economic welfare of Metropolitan Nashville and Davidson County.

    B.

    The purpose and mission of this SONA CBID is hereby declared to be: To undertake and provide an enhanced level of programs and services not provided by the metropolitan government which will help maintain the central business district of South Nashville as a clean, safe, and vibrant place to work, live, shop and play. This should include but not be limited to funding the necessary roadway improvements and maintenance as well as any appurtenances designed to improve access and overall traffic flow, and funding and maintaining other public improvements and appurtenances within the district related to water and sewer infrastructure as well as the development of a public greenway.

(Ord. BL2018-1140 § 1, 2018)
